What Is Structural Carpentry?
Structural carpentry is all about the construction and maintenance of the structural framework of a building. This includes the wooden parts that are responsible for supporting the weight of the building and holding it together.
These wooden parts are designed to work in conjunction with each other to distribute the weight of the roof, from the top of the building down to the foundation. This is done to keep the building well-balanced and stable.
Typical structural carpentry jobs include:
- Framing or interior and exterior walls
- Installing beams, posts, and columns
- Building floor and ceiling joist systems
- Roof framing with rafters or trusses
- Building subfloors and structural platforms
- Replacing or strengthening a weakened frame
If a component is involved in supporting loads or maintaining alignment, it is considered structural carpentry.

Circumstances That Require Structural Carpentry Services
Structural carpentry services are needed in situations involving significant renovations or when signs of structural damage are observed.
Home Renovations and Extensions
When walls are removed, floor plans are opened up, or new rooms are added, it is likely that the load-bearing structure will be affected. Structural carpenters will ensure that the structure remains supported throughout the renovation process.
Damage from Water or Moisture
In UK homes, leaks, flooding, and prolonged exposure to moisture can compromise wood framing. Structural carpentry repairs will restore integrity and protect the structure from further damage.
Natural Settling of Older Structures
With time, homes tend to settle or shift. Sloping floors, drywall damage, and uneven doors are common signs of structural problems that need expert evaluation.
Structural Damage by Pests
Insects can damage structural components without being noticed. Structural carpenters will replace the compromised structure and reinforce the affected area.
